Transaction 51558749a2c227440e9356a501b75b7634f19a7db5787a7e23afca4e81372d0e

1 Input
2 Outputs
  • 51558749a2c227440e9356a501b75b7634f19a7db5787a7e23afca4e81372d0e:0
  • value  1182856
    address  3EsqCRN1L8BbS5Wu9LocPGDLJfycNSEFJH
  • 51558749a2c227440e9356a501b75b7634f19a7db5787a7e23afca4e81372d0e:1
  • value  2807412
    address  1Aj6TQYRaNgjc9cYUX2Q72LBBtShh9Jzgr